Colombian superstar Karol G closed out the 2026 Coachella Valley Music and Arts Festival on Sunday night, becoming the first Latina artist ever to headline the Indio, California festival and announcing a world tour in support of her fourth studio album, "Tropicoqueta."
Karol G took the Coachella main stage at 10:10 pm PT on Sunday, April 19, Timeout LA reported, capping the second and final weekend of the festival at the Empire Polo Club. Her ascent to a Coachella headline slot makes her the first Latina artist to hold the honor, a milestone the festival has moved toward over the past several editions but only formalized this year.
Across the two weekends of the 2026 edition, which ran April 10-19, Sabrina Carpenter, Justin Bieber and Karol G split the three headline slots. Billboard subsequently reported a Coachella chart bump for all three on its Billboard 200 chart.
During her Weekend 2 closer, Karol G brought out J Balvin, Peso Pluma, Becky G and Ryan Castro as surprise guests, turning the set into a wide-ranging showcase of contemporary Latin pop and reggaeton, Rolling Stone and Complex reported. Each guest joined for a cameo before Karol G returned to her own catalog.
Midway through the set, Karol G used the Coachella stage to announce a global tour in support of "Tropicoqueta," her fourth studio album, per Rolling Stone. Dates for the tour were teased during the show, with formal routing expected to follow.
For Coachella, which has increasingly leaned into pop and global-music programming, the Karol G close punctuates a festival cycle that drew praise for the diversity of its headline bookings and underscored the mainstreaming of Latin music at the largest Western festivals.
